Factors Affecting Cost
- Extent of Damage: More severe foundation issues will require more extensive repairs, increasing the overall cost.
- Type of Foundation: Different foundation types (slab, crawl space, basement) have varying repair costs.
- Soil Conditions: The type of soil and its moisture content can impact the complexity and cost of repairs.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require additional labor and equipment, raising the cost.
- Repair Method: Different methods (piering, slab jacking, etc.) have different costs associated with them.
- Labor Rates: Local labor costs in Sioux City, IA can influence the overall price of the repair.
- Permit Fees: Obtaining necessary permits can add to the total cost of the project.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ost in Sioux City, IA |
---|---|
Foundation Crack Repair | $500 - $1,200 |
Basement Waterproofing | $1,500 - $4,500 |
Slab Jacking |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Piering and Underpinning | $1,000 - $3,000 per pier |
Structural Reinforcement |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Crawl Space Repair | $5,000 - $15,000 |
